Sorts Of Stress Washing Machines
When it involves press washing, recognizing the different kinds of pressure washing machines readily available can make a substantial difference in your cleansing efficiency.
You'll typically run into 3 primary kinds: electrical, gas, and hot water stress washing machines.
Electric stress washers are optimal for light-duty jobs, such as washing autos or cleaning up outdoor patios. They're quieter, simpler to make use of, and ideal for smaller jobs around your home.
If you need even more power for harder tasks, gas stress washers are the method to go. They're much more effective and can take care of heavy-duty jobs like removing paint or cleansing large driveways. For those truly difficult work, warm water stress washing machines offer the best cleansing power. They heat up the water, making it reliable for getting rid of grease and oil spots. These are normally made use of in industrial settings however can be advantageous for property customers taking on difficult cleaning jobs.
Choosing the appropriate kind of pressure washer for your requirements will aid you save time and effort, guaranteeing you get the job done effectively.
Safety and security Precautions
Before diving into your pressure cleaning job, it's important to focus on security preventative measures to safeguard on your own and your environments. First, use proper equipment, consisting of security goggles, handwear covers, and non-slip footwear. These products will certainly shield you from particles and high-pressure water.
Next off, bear in mind your tools. Inspect the stress washer for any kind of leakages or damages before usage. See to it all connections are tight, and always adhere to the maker's instructions relating to procedure and maintenance.
When working with chemicals, ensure you're in a well-ventilated area and wear a mask to prevent breathing in unsafe fumes. Maintain a first aid package close by for any kind of minor injuries that may occur throughout the job.
Remember to preserve a secure distance from electric outlets, high-voltage line, and other prospective hazards. Be cautious of unsafe surfaces, especially when utilizing water on pathways or driveways.
Finally, prevent pointing the nozzle at individuals, pet dogs, or delicate surface areas. By adhering to these security precautions, you'll produce a safer work environment and reduce the threat of accidents or injuries while pressure cleaning.

Best Practices for Stress Washing
One of the very best methods for stress cleaning is to begin with a detailed evaluation of the surface area you'll be cleaning up. Next off, choose the right nozzle and stress setup for the work. A wide-angle nozzle is wonderful for fragile surfaces, while a narrow one works well for tougher discolorations. Constantly begin with the most affordable stress and progressively enhance it if needed.
Prior to you start, clear the area of any obstacles and secure plants, windows, and various other surfaces that may be harmed by the spray.
When washing, keep the nozzle at a constant range from the surface area, and use sweeping movements to prevent streaks. Work from top to bottom to make sure that dirt and debris fall away as you cleanse.
Ultimately, wash the location completely to eliminate any kind of soap or cleaning solution residues. After you're done, examine your job to ensure you didn't miss any type of places.
Complying with these ideal practices will certainly assist you attain the best results while lengthening the life of your surfaces.
